#68c0fd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#68c0fd is composed of 40.8% red, 75.3% green and 99.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.9% cyan, 24.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 0.8% black. It has a hue angle of 204.6 degrees, a saturation of 97.4% and a lightness of 70%. #68c0fd color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ffff with #0081fb. Closest websafe color is: #66ccff.

Shades and Tints of #68c0fd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000204 is the darkest color, while #f0f9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#68c0fd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#afb3b6 is the less saturated color, while #68c0fd is the most saturated one.
